Warm Spaces across Rutland and Stamford could be given a boost by National Grid.
Warm Welcome has a network of over 4,000 projects, 400 of them have received funding from the power company through their Community Matters Fund, including several in Lincolnshire. The news comes after a summit chaired by former Prime Minister Gordon Brown discussed how businesses can best support their local communities, particularly becoming corporate partners in projects tackling loneliness and isolation.
